
The dream for Team Ellan Vannin is alive.
They have clinched a place in the final of the ConIFA World Football Cup in Sweden after a 4-1 victory over Arameans Suryoye.
Despite falling behind in the 10th minute, Ciaran McNulty equalised and they then turned on the style in the second half with Jack McVey, Chris Bass junior and McNulty sealing a memorable win.
Tipped at 250/1 to win the competition at the start of the tournament, they will face the French county of Nice in Sunday’s final.
Ellan Vannin defeated them 4-2 in their group match on Tuesday.
